K924Stationary Flash-Butt Rail Welding Machine

The K924 is a specialised stationary rail welding machine developed for production of welded railway crossing, switch and turnout components. Unlike conventional straight-rail production machines, K924 is engineered for demanding component geometries and high-manganese materials.
The current K924 offer describes intermediate welding using a stainless-steel rail insert and welding of high-manganese crossings and switches with cross-sectional areas up to 15,000 mm².

Technology & System Architecture

The delivery set includes the K924 welding machine with clamping device and flash remover for the customer-specified rail profile and crossing, pumping station, portable control panel, control cabinet, computer cabinet, computer, laser printer, mounting parts and warranty spare parts / tools.

Control & Quality
K924 uses a SIEMENS programmable microprocessor controller with Bosch Rexroth hydraulic systems. The control architecture supports precise execution of welding programs, real-time parameter recording, full process monitoring and automatic reporting for each weld. An optional GSM module is stated for remote monitoring.

Technical Specifications

  • Nominal supply voltage

    400 V

  • Frequency

    50 ± 0.2 Hz

  • Maximum secondary current

    ≤ 55 kA

  • Short-circuit power

    ≥ 400 ± 40 kVA

  • Nominal continuous secondary current

    19 kA

  • Power at DC=50%

    180 kVA

  • Maximum upset force

    1,500 kN

  • Maximum clamping force

    4,000 kN

  • Upset speed

    ≥ 100 mm/s

  • Maximum movable-column stroke

    ≥ 115 ± 3 mm

  • Maximum weldable cross-section

    15,000 mm²

  • Output

    From 8 welds/h under optimal conditions

Standards

• European Directives 2014/30/EU, 2006/42/EC and 2014/35/EU
• Welding process: EN 14587-2
